All cooked noodles are safe during pregnancy — egg noodles, rice noodles, udon, soba, ramen noodles, and glass noodles. They provide carbohydrates for energy. Egg noodles are cooked, so the egg is safe.
A "Generally Safe" rating means this food doesn’t carry a pregnancy-specific safety concern beyond ordinary food-handling practices — the same basic hygiene and storage habits that apply to anyone. These ratings are based on general guidance from the FDA, ACOG, CDC, and USDA rather than a claim that every possible preparation of the food is automatically fine; how something is prepared, stored, and served still matters. If a "generally safe" food has any handling caveats (like a preparation method or freshness window), they’re noted separately in the sections below rather than changing the overall rating.
